One significant trait of onion is the high content of chromium. This crucial mineral is responsible for metabolizing all the macronutrients the body encounters. A better metabolizing of fats, proteins and fat means much less waste for the kidneys to handle. The less strain the kidneys experience, the more durable they will be in your later years.

Furthermore, onions also contain very low amounts of potassium. This is important because of certain kidney conditions. When they are in a dire state, they can no longer process excess potassium. The levels in the body quickly build up and you will contract hyperkalemia. Some of the symptoms are nausea, vomiting, and numbness throughout the body. Kidney Beans

Kidney beans have a lot of nutritional value that helps the health of the kidneys. Call it a coincidence in its name, it’s shaped like the body organ – the kidney. What makes them unique are their soluble and insoluble fiber properties and low fat. These assists in promoting cardiovascular well-being and keeps your blood pressure low.

The fiber in kidney beans assists to regulate blood sugar levels. They have low amounts of sodium, sugar, and cholesterol. They are a rich source of low-fat protein, magnesium, potassium and amino acids. It has to be noted that a lack of magnesium and potassium in the body can increase the risks of getting kidney stones.

They are not only used in homes as part of the delicious food but as treating kidney stone problems as well. The kidney stone pain can be treated by cooking the pods after removing the beans in purified water. You can then strain and drink after cooling it. It’s as easy as that!

You don’t want to miss it because kidney beans should also be taken by those who don’t have kidney problems. They generally contribute to an overall balanced diet and kidney health. For those who already have kidney problems, the kidney bean is a great source of getting the required nutrients.

However, this needs to be carefully monitored and controlled because kidney beans have phosphorus, potassium, protein, and magnesium. The kidneys will remove any of the dietary excesses from your body. If there are excess proteins, this can promote the loss of kidney tissues.

For those suffering from chronic kidney problems, the presence of potassium, phosphorus, and magnesium can cause the kidneys to overwork which is supposed to be avoided at all costs in such situations. It’s advisable to seek medical advice from your doctor in such situations.

1. Oatmeal

ADVERTISEMENT - CONTINUE READING BELOW

This amazing type of grain has many benefits. Besides being the world-famous breakfast choice, it serves other purposes, as well. It is packed with nutrients and fibers that everyone’s body needs. Oatmeal contains vitamins and minerals that can help with preventing many dangerous diseases. On the plus side, hair, skin and nails are enhanced by this beneficial grain also.

Saponin in oatmeal helps with natural exfoliating, no matter what skin type you have. It removes dead skin cells and makes your skin glow. Minerals mixed with proteins in the oatmeal keep your skin hydrated longer. It stops water loss and moisturizes your skin. Also, oatmeal can be a crucial component to help you with eczema, rashes, psoriasis and many other diseases.

  • Find a bowl and put 2 tablespoons of instant oatmeal in it. Add 1 tablespoon of honey along with 2 tablespoons of plain yogurt. When that is done, massage your face using circular motions with this paste. After applying it, let it sit on your skin for about 10-15 minutes. Later on, take it all off with water and gently dry your skin. The final step is putting on a light moisturizer. It will remove all dead cells from your skin.
  • There is another way to help your skin with oatmeal. You will need a bowl, 2 tablespoons of oatmeal, 2 or 3 teaspoons of honey and 2 teaspoons of lemon juice. Mix them all up and add a little water to make a thick mixture. For about 5 minutes rub this paste with light movements on your skin. Before rinsing it off, leave it on for about 10 minutes. You can repeat this process one more time in a week. If you want, you can put this on your body as well.

3. Green tea

ADVERTISEMENT - CONTINUE READING BELOW

We all know the benefits that green tea contains when it comes to our internal health. Well, now you can double those benefits! Besides your body, you can help your skin with this amazing beverage too. Just by making a homemade skin scrub from the used tea bags, dead skin cells won’t have a place on your skin anymore.

It consists of a plethora of nutrients. A huge amount of antioxidants, amino acids, enzymes, vitamins, and caffeine will have an amazing impact on you. Drinking green tea and then applying it as a beauty mask will enhance your outside as much as the inside. Its vitamin K and antioxidants can help with treating dark circles under your eyes. You will look a lot younger and aging signs will vanish.

To remove dirt and exfoliate your skin, you can make this mixture with just a few simple steps. Along with that, you will remove dead skin cells in no time. Also, this can work as a toner. It will reduce large pores and prevent your skin from dehydration. Therefore, you won’t have to be scared to expose yourself to the sun. This well-treated skin will be hard to break.

  • Put in a bowl, the contents of 1 or 2 used green tea bags. Mix them with 2 to 3 teaspoons of honey. If you want, you can add 1 tablespoon of baking soda. After adding these, mix them all up until you achieve a thick paste. Apply the mixture on your face and leave it to sit on for about 10 minutes. Wet your fingers and then carefully scrub off the mask. Repeat this process once a week.

10. Dry brushing

ADVERTISEMENT - CONTINUE READING BELOW

It is normal to brush our hair and teeth regularly. What about your skin? Why is that an exception? Dry brushing has become very popular because of its potential benefits. They go from healthier-looking skin to healing lymphatic drainage.

Usually, it’s recommended before showering. The direction should be from the feet toward the chest. Don’t forget that you are doing a big favor to your skin. It will thank you later. Dry brushing promotes normal lymph flow by transporting lymph through the body. It also helps with removing dead skin cells and exfoliating the skin. Therefore, the skin is softer and nourished.

By regularly brushing your skin, the first signs of improvement will show up sooner than you have expected. It will open up your pores and allow your skin to breathe. Tighter skin and an improved texture are always wanted, so don’t hesitate to try this method.

  • Before you start to brush, make sure that your skin is clean. Dryness is important to watch for because of the use of moisturizer later. Start slowly and be gentle to your skin. Being too harsh can cause redness and irritation.
  • Like we said, you should start by brushing your feet. Slowly go up and brush your legs, stomach area, chest, arms, and shoulders. It should last for about 10 to 20 minutes. After you are done, go for a nice and relaxing shower. The final step is to pat dry your skin with a soft towel and apply a moisturizer. This process can be done few times a week for the best results.
